Starting in June, you can take advantage of several new features in George Business. We have added the option to request SWIFT confirmations for international payments and the ability to display account balances when exporting transaction history to Excel.

SWIFT Confirmations for SEPA and International Payments

When entering one-off SEPA or international payments, you can request a SWIFT confirmation of the transaction.

How to request a SWIFT confirmation?

  • At the bottom of the payment form, under “SWIFT confirmation on payment execution,” tick “Receive it via email.”
  • After ticking the box, you will see a field with a pre-filled e-mail address where the SWIFT confirmation will be sent. You can edit the address if needed.
  • We will send the SWIFT confirmation once the payment has been processed.
  • This is a paid service according to the current price list.

Opening and Closing Account Balances in Transaction History

Since April, information about the opening and closing balance of an account has been available when searching transaction history and when printing it as a PDF.

As of June, this feature has been expanded: you can now also display these balances when exporting transaction history to Excel. If you search transactions across multiple accounts, you can also view opening and closing balances in the Excel export or in the PDF printout.

Exporting Transaction History to MS Excel

Export from a single account

  • In the account's transaction history, search for the desired transactions for a selected period and click “Export” in the top-right corner.
  • In the panel that opens on the right, choose the “MS Excel (.xlsx)” format, select the fields you want to include, and keep the “Opening/closing balance” option checked under “Options.”
  • Review the preview at the bottom and click “Download.”

Export across all accounts

  • In the top blue bar, search for transactions for a selected period.
  • Click “Export” in the top-right corner. In the panel on the right, keep the “Opening/closing balance” box checked.
  • If the results contain transactions from more than 10 accounts, balances will be shown only for the first ten.

E-mail Confirmation for Manually Entered Bulk Payments

Just like with one-off payments, you can now request an e-mail confirmation when manually entering a bulk payment.

  • In the first step of entering the bulk payment, tick the E-mail confirmation box and provide the e-mail address where the confirmation should be sent.
  • Then select the language in which the confirmation should be issued — Czech or English.
  • Once the payment is processed, we will send the confirmation of the bulk payment to the specified e-mail address.

You can also request an e-mail confirmation when creating a payment template or when using a template to enter a payment.
